New, cleaner package repository structure.

Package repositories now look like this:

    top-level-dir/
        repo.yaml
        packages/
            libelf/
                package.py
            mpich/
                package.py
            ...

This leaves room at the top level for additional metadata, source,
per-repo configs, indexes, etc., and it makes it easy to see that
something is a spack repo (just look for repo.yaml and packages).

from spack import *
# typical working line with extrae 3.0.1
# ./configure --prefix=/usr/local --with-mpi=/usr/lib64/mpi/gcc/openmpi --with-unwind=/usr/local --with-papi=/usr --with-dwarf=/usr --with-elf=/usr --with-dyninst=/usr --with-binutils=/usr --with-xml-prefix=/usr --enable-openmp --enable-nanos --enable-pthread --disable-parallel-merge LDFLAGS=-pthread
class Extrae(Package):
"""Extrae is the package devoted to generate tracefiles which can
be analyzed later by Paraver. Extrae is a tool that uses
different interposition mechanisms to inject probes into the
target application so as to gather information regarding the
application performance. The Extrae instrumentation package can
instrument the MPI programin model, and the following parallel
programming models either alone or in conjunction with MPI :
OpenMP, CUDA, OpenCL, pthread, OmpSs"""
homepage = "http://www.bsc.es/computer-sciences/extrae"
url = "http://www.bsc.es/ssl/apps/performanceTools/files/extrae-3.0.1.tar.bz2"
version('3.0.1', 'a6a8ca96cd877723cd8cc5df6bdb922b')
depends_on("mpi")
depends_on("dyninst")
depends_on("libunwind")
depends_on("boost")
depends_on("libdwarf")
depends_on("papi")
def install(self, spec, prefix):
if 'openmpi' in spec:
mpi = spec['openmpi']
elif 'mpich' in spec:
mpi = spec['mpich']
elif 'mvapich2' in spec:
mpi = spec['mvapich2']
configure("--prefix=%s" % prefix,
"--with-mpi=%s" % mpi.prefix,
"--with-unwind=%s" % spec['libunwind'].prefix,
"--with-dyninst=%s" % spec['dyninst'].prefix,
"--with-boost=%s" % spec['boost'].prefix,
"--with-dwarf=%s" % spec['libdwarf'].prefix,
"--with-papi=%s" % spec['papi'].prefix,
"--with-dyninst-headers=%s" % spec['dyninst'].prefix.include,
"--with-dyninst-libs=%s" % spec['dyninst'].prefix.lib)
make()
make("install", parallel=False)
